Summary:
There's a killer in Crime Alley and Planetary has been called into Gotham to catch him. Because on their Earth, there is no Batman to protect Gotham. There is only Elijah Snow, Jakita Wagner and the Drummer to stop a man with an out-of-control personal distortion field who's leaving a grotesque trail of bodies in the streets. As their killer rewrites reality at random, Gotham changes--and the Batman appears in the middle of the night. But as Gotham changes, so does the Batman's behavior. The only constant: the relentlessness of the Caped Crusader to bring the killer to justice--even if that means keeping him out of Planetary's hands!
